question 18 of 20 : select the best answer for the question. 18. plants have many different hormones that influence their growth, development, and life cycle. for example, a cluster of over-ripe bananas on the counter can cause a newer apple to begin to ripen more quickly and go bad. which hormone below is found in many fruits and can become airborne and cause over-ripening and abscission? a. cytokin b. abscisic acid c. ethylene d. auxin mark for review (will be highlighted on the review page)
Brief Explanations
To solve this, we analyze each option:
- Option A: Cytokinins promote cell division and growth, not over - ripening or abscission.
- Option B: Abscisic acid is involved in stress responses and dormancy, not fruit ripening.
- Option C: Ethylene is a gaseous hormone produced by many fruits. It is airborne and causes over - ripening and abscission (the shedding of plant parts like fruits). The example of over - ripe bananas causing apples to ripen faster is due to ethylene.
- Option D: Auxins are involved in cell elongation, apical dominance, etc., not fruit ripening.
